History
The Sir Charles Bell Society (SCBS) began as an informal
group in 1992 during the VIIth International Facial Nerve Symposium
(President: Professor E. Stennert) in Cologne. At this initial meeting
74 attendees confirmed the need for a multinational approach. Drs. Olaf
Michel and Kedar Adour were appointed as coordinators and under their
guidance the original 74 attendees were to be considered as “Founding
Members” and they drafted a Statement of Purpose: “The SCBS
is to be an international forum for clinicians of all medical specialties
and researchers in basic or clinical science who have as special interest
in the facial nerve and its disorders. This unique international multi-disciplinary
organization is dedicated to the collection, dissemination and exchange
of ideas relating to the facial nerve and its diseases.” Their
first charge was to aid Professor Naoki Yanagihara in organizing the
VIIIth International Facial Nerve Symposium to be held in Japan in 1997.
The Sir Charles Bell Society was officially recognized
June 23, 1993, incorporated in the state of California as a non-profit
mutual benefit corporation organized under the non-profit mutual benefit
corporation law meeting the criteria of: Internal Revenue Code Section
501 C (6) with FEDERAL Employee Identification Number: 94-320802 and
California Corporate Number; 1917755 SCOBS.
Thanks to the diligent effort of Tom Ekstrand (Sweden)
with the able assistance of Paul Mulkens (The Netherlands) and Gisle
Djupesland (Norway) the first scheduled meeting of the SCBS convened
in Istanbul on June 23, 1993 during the International Federation of
Otolaryngological Societies Meeting (IFOS). The 21 attendees represented
10 countries.
In 1997 the proximity of IFOS and the VIIIth Facial
Nerve Symposium, prevented many SCBS members from attending the IFOS-
meeting in Australia. Therefore the planned preliminary organizational
meeting of the SCBS in Sydney was limited. Under the guidance of Tom
Ekstrand, our ad-hoc treasurer and chairman of the By Laws Committee
an informal agenda had been prepared by Drs Kedar Adour, Pieter Devriese
and Tom Ekstrand. Present and participating were: Adour K., Cousins
V., Croxson G., Devriese P., Ekstrand T., Federspil P.A., Gavilán
J., Hanner P., Le Roux B., Herranz-Gonzales J.
The final organizational meeting was held April 15,
1997 at the VIIIth International Facial Nerve Symposium in Matsuyama,
Japan. Tom Ekstrand and Paul Mulkens were selected as Chairman and Secretary

At the first official election there was a unanimous
vote for Kedar Adour, President; Olaf Michel, Secretary and Tom Ekstrand,
Treasurer.
Membership includes otolaryngologists, plastic-reconstructive
surgeons, neurologists, neurosurgeons, basic science researchers, physiotherapists,
audiologists, anatomists, psychologists, psychiatrists, radiologists,
and internists. At present there are over 229 members from 32 countries.
In 2001 the Members Meeting was held in San Francisco/USA
at the IXth International Facial Nerve Symposium under the chairmanship
of Kedar Adour & Robert Jackler with election of Rainer Laskawi
(Germany), President; Jacqueline Diels (USA), Secretary and Larry Lundy
(USA), Treasurer. Kedar Adour (USA),who had to step back after two terms,
was elected to Honorary Member President-Emeritus with unanimous votes.
The 2005 Members Meeting of the SCBS was held in Maastricht/Netherlands
during the "Xth International Facial Nerve Symposium (Chairman:
Hans Manni)” with election of a new Executive Committee: Rainer
Laskawi (Germany), President; Jacqueline Diels (USA), Secretary and
Paul Mulkens (Netherlands) as a new Treasurer. Unfortunately Kedar Adour
(USA) the President-Emeritus and Honorary Member was not able to attend.

The venue of the last Members Meeting in 2009 was in
Rome during the "XIth International Facial Nerve Symposium"
(Chairmen: Roberto Filipo / Maurizio Barbara). By acclamation Naoki
Yanagihara was elected to Honorary Member. The by voting new composed
Executive Committee consists Henri Marres (Netherlands), President;
Tessa Hadlock (USA), Secretary and Xavier Gavilan (Spain) as Assessor.
Paul Mulkens (Netherlands) was re-elected as Treasurer. After presentations
(Antalya, Turkey and Boston, USA) and voting for next venue it was decided
the XIIth. Symposium in 2013 will be organised in Boston.
